Refrigerator and method for controlling refrigeration of refrigerator
By installing a weight sensor inside the refrigerator to detect weight changes in the storage compartment, identify information on items being placed or removed, and adjust the compressor's operating parameters, the problem of frost-free refrigerators being unable to accurately match cooling power is solved. This achieves precise cooling control, reduces energy waste, and improves cooling efficiency and the refrigerator's energy efficiency.

[0001] The present application relates to the technical field of refrigerators, and in particular to a refrigerator and a self-cleaning control method of the refrigerator. BACKGROUND
[0002] Generally, the air-cooled refrigerator controls the start and stop of the compressor by detecting the actual temperature of the temperature sensor of each chamber to realize the control of the temperature of each chamber. When the indoor temperature is higher than the temperature of the probe, the machine is started, and when the indoor temperature is lower than the temperature of the probe, the machine is stopped. In this way, the temperature is within the limited value.
[0003] However, the food in the refrigerator is constantly changing when the user uses the refrigerator. The existing variable frequency refrigerator starts the high speed mode when the door is opened or the sensor temperature rises. However, the food in the refrigerator is constantly changing when the user uses the refrigerator. The existing fixed control mode does not match the total amount of food in the refrigerator, and cannot control the refrigeration according to the cold demand of the food in the refrigerator. The refrigeration power of the refrigerator is not accurate enough, which will cause waste of cold and power, and affect the refrigeration effect of the refrigerator. SUMMARY

[0049] Compared with the prior art, the refrigerator and the refrigeration control method of the refrigerator disclosed by the application, when it is detected that the door body changes from the closed state to the open state, the weight change information is obtained by detecting the weight change in the storage chamber each time during the period when the door body changes from the open state to the closed state through the weight sensor; when the weight change information is not empty, the taking and placing information of the user during the period is identified according to the obtained weight change information and the preset article weight library, and the taking and placing information includes the weight information of the taken article and / or the weight information of the newly placed article; the required cold quantity is calculated according to the identified taking and placing information, and the working parameter of the compressor is controlled according to the calculated required cold quantity. By using the technical means of the embodiment of the application, each step of taking out or placing in the article can be accurately determined. In the prior art, the weight of the newly placed article and the taken out article may be offset, but the interference of the two on the cold quantity in the refrigerator is not the same. The newly placed article is a normal temperature article, and additional cold quantity is required to reduce the temperature of the article to the preset temperature of the refrigerator, while the taken out article does not need to be deducted corresponding cold quantity. When the power is adjusted according to each weight change in the prior art, the taking and placing behavior of the user needs to be controlled and adjusted for many times during the opening of the door, and the working condition of the compressor is frequently changed, which may cause a large amount of energy waste and reduce the service life of the compressor. Therefore, the application can accurately identify each article taking, accurately calculate the cold quantity change process during the opening of the door, and accurately realize the refrigeration control by using a one-time adjustment scheme. Specifically, referring to Figure 2 , it is a structural schematic diagram of a refrigeration system of a refrigerator provided by an embodiment of the present application. The refrigeration system is composed of a compressor 201, a condenser 202, a drying filter 203, a capillary tube 204 and an evaporator 205. The working composition of the refrigeration system comprises a compression process, a condensation process, a throttling process and an evaporation process.
[0068] Among them, the compression process is that the refrigerator power cord is plugged in, and the compressor starts to work when the cabinet has refrigeration demand. The low-temperature and low-pressure refrigerant is sucked into the compressor, and is compressed into high-temperature and high-pressure superheated gas in the cylinder of the compressor, and then is discharged to the condenser. The condensation process is that the high-temperature and high-pressure refrigerant gas is cooled by the condenser, and the temperature is constantly lowered, and is gradually cooled into saturated vapor at normal temperature and high pressure, and is further cooled into saturated liquid, and the temperature no longer decreases. At this time, the temperature is called condensation temperature. The pressure of the refrigerant in the whole condensation process is almost unchanged. The throttling process is that the saturated liquid refrigerant after condensation is filtered to remove water and impurities by the drying filter, and then flows into the capillary tube to reduce the pressure by throttling, and the refrigerant becomes wet vapor at normal temperature and low pressure. The evaporation process is that then the heat is absorbed in the evaporator to vaporize, not only the temperature of the evaporator and its surrounding is lowered, but also the refrigerant becomes low-temperature and low-pressure gas. The refrigerant from the evaporator returns to the compressor again, and repeats the above process, so as to transfer the heat in the refrigerator to the air outside the cabinet, and achieve the purpose of refrigeration.

[0079] The weight sensor is usually converted into an electrical output by a combination of spring elements and strain gauges. Among the various types of load cells, different models and styles can be distinguished by two key ways: 1. By the method they use to detect weight, load cells are divided into tension-compression load cells, tension load cells, and other measurement types; by the type of output signal generated, load cells are divided into hydraulic load cells, piezoelectric load cells, and various other configurations. Any type of load cell is always designed to work in the direction of gravity. The weight sensor used in the embodiment can be any one, which is used to convert the weight of the stored items in the storage compartment into an electrical signal output.
[0080] In order to improve the weight detection accuracy, the storage box in different storage compartments can be weighed respectively; see Figure 5 , which is a structural schematic diagram of a storage compartment provided by the embodiment of the present application. The storage box 501 of the storage compartment is distributed below the weight sensor 404, and a tension-compression load cell distributed below the storage compartment is used to detect the weight of the storage compartment.
[0081] In order to provide the weighing accuracy of the storage box and avoid the influence of the placement position of the items on the weighing, a plurality of weight sensors can be uniformly or non-uniformly distributed below the storage box, see Figure 6 , which is a structural schematic diagram of the bottom surface of the storage box provided by the embodiment of the present application. The bottom surface 601 of the storage box is distributed with a plurality of distributed sensors 602 for detecting weight, which are used to accurately detect the weight of the items in the storage box of the storage compartment.

[0099] It should be noted that in the present embodiment, when the controller identifies that the weight change information is an empty set, it indicates that the user does not take any articles in the storage chamber at this time, and the working parameter of the compressor can not be controlled at this time, or other conventional control strategies of the prior art can be used to control the compressor.
[0100] It should be noted that in the present embodiment, after the required cold quantity is calculated, the compressor power can be controlled to be increased or decreased according to the size of the required cold quantity, or the compressor speed can be increased or decreased according to the size of the required cold quantity, so as to realize accurate control of refrigeration.
[0101] In the embodiment, the weight change in the storage compartment of the refrigerator each time the door is opened is calculated, the process of taking out and putting in the articles each time is calculated, the cold quantity change required for storing the articles in the storage compartment is accurately calculated, and the cold quantity is accurately calculated. Compared with the prior art of detecting the initial value of the article weight in the storage compartment before the door is opened and calculating the article change value after the door is closed, the present application can accurately calculate each step of taking out or putting in the articles. In the prior art, the weight of the new articles put in and the articles taken out may be offset, but the interference of the two on the cold quantity in the refrigerator is not the same. The newly put-in articles are normal-temperature articles, and additional cold quantity is required to reduce the articles to the preset temperature of the refrigerator, and the taken-out articles do not need to be deducted the corresponding cold quantity. When the power is adjusted according to the weight change each time in another prior art, the user's taking and putting behavior during the opening of the door needs to be controlled and adjusted multiple times, the compressor working condition is frequently changed, a large amount of energy is wasted, and the service life of the compressor is reduced. Therefore, the present application can accurately identify the taking of the articles each time, accurately calculate the cold quantity change process during the opening of the door, adopt a one-time adjustment scheme, and accurately realize the refrigeration control.

[0168] It should be noted that in this determination process, the weight reduction of the removed item is compared with the product of a certain weight information in the item weight database and a certain ratio in the preset ratio database, which can accurately identify and take the item; by setting the preset ratio database, it can accurately identify the partial taking of the object; by setting the first preset interval, it can eliminate the error of the weight sensor and the error of the object when taking it.
[0169] The preset ratio library N contains specific ratio elements such as 1, 1 / 2, 1 / 3, 1 / 4, and 1 / 6, representing the standard portions of items. When the selected ratio element in the preset ratio library is 1, it indicates that the entire item in the storage room is taken. When the ratio element is another element, such as 1 / 2, it indicates that a portion of the item in the storage room is taken. For example, if six bottles of beverages are stored in the storage room at once, the item weight library only contains the total weight of the six bottles, which is 2040g. If a user takes one bottle, the weight decreases by 339g. In this case, comparing the total weight alone cannot identify the taking action. However, by using the set ratio library and the first preset interval, the taking of a single bottle of beverage can be accurately identified.

[0177] It should be noted that in this determination process, the weight decrease value of the taken object is compared with the product of any weight information in the object weight library and any proportion in the preset proportion library, which can accurately identify whether the taken object is the object placed this time; through the setting of the preset proportion library, the partial taking of the object can be accurately identified; through the first preset interval setting, the errors of the weight sensor and the object during taking can be excluded.
[0178] The specific proportion elements in the preset proportion library N include 1, 1 / 2, 1 / 3, 1 / 4, 1 / 6, etc. When the selected proportion element of the preset proportion library is 1, it means that the object in the storage chamber is taken in its entirety, and when the proportion element is other elements, for example, 1 / 2, it means that the object in the storage chamber is taken partially. For example, 6 bottles of beverages are taken from the storage chamber at a time, and at this time, the weight change information only includes the weight of the 6 bottles of beverages as a whole, that is, 2040g, and at this time, the user puts back one of the bottles, and the weight increase value is 339g. At this time, only the whole weight comparison cannot identify the taking and putting back behavior, and it is easy to identify it as a newly placed object. Through the setting of the proportion library and the first preset interval, the taking and putting back of a single bottle of beverage can be accurately identified.
[0179] It should be noted that the more the number of the preset proportion library is set, the more accurate the partial taking can be identified, but the more the setting is, the more likely it is to cause misidentification, therefore, in specific implementation, the first preset interval range can be set to be larger, and the proportion elements in the preset proportion library can be set to be the proportion between common single objects and assembled objects, for example, common canned beverages generally adopt 6 bottles to form a piece, so as to improve the identification accuracy and avoid misidentification.

[0222] It should be noted that this process of detecting the objects in the refrigerator by weight is different from the scheme of managing objects by tags in the prior art. The tag scheme in the prior art is more applied to monitoring the freshness of food and monitoring specific different object type information, and most of them need the cumbersome process of manually adding tags, and it is difficult to realize autonomous monitoring. And when calculating the cold quantity, the type of the object does not need to be considered, so the weight identification scheme meets the accuracy requirement of the cold quantity calculation of the present application, and can realize object weight management without manually adding tags, which is more efficient.
